What are the 3 things that affect depth of field?
You can affect the depth of field by changing the following factors: aperture, the focal length and the distance from the subject.
What is the easiest way to create depth of field?
The bigger the aperture (which corresponds to a smaller f/stop number), the more shallow your depth of field. The easiest way to do this is to set your camera to Aperture Priority, and then dial in the aperture value you want–the camera will automatically respond with the right shutter speed.
How do you capture deep depth of field?
To achieve a deep depth of field, the aperture must be set to an f/16 or smaller. A clearer image and larger field of view will also be possible if you station the camera as far away as the subject as possible, and choose a lens with a shorter focal length.

What is the maximum depth of field?
In optics and photography, hyperfocal distance is a distance beyond which all objects can be brought into an “acceptable” focus. As the hyperfocal distance is the focus distance giving the maximum depth of field, it is the most desirable distance to set the focus of a fixed-focus camera.

What f stop has the greatest depth of field?
The aperture is the setting that beginners typically use to control depth of field. The wider the aperture (smaller f-number f/1.4 to f/4), the shallower the depth of field. On the contrary, the smaller the aperture (large f-number: f/11 to f/22), the deeper the depth of field.
Which F-stop is sharpest?
The sharpest aperture of your lens, known as the sweet spot, is located two to three f/stops from the widest aperture. Therefore, the sharpest aperture on my 16-35mm f/4 is between f/8 and f/11. A faster lens, such as the 14-24mm f/2.8, has a sweet spot between f/5.6 and f/8.
How is the depth of field of an object determined?
Depth of field is the distance between the nearest and the furthest objects that are in acceptably sharp focus. “Acceptably sharp focus” is defined using a property called the circle of confusion. The depth of field is determined by focal length, distance to subject, the acceptable circle of confusion size, and aperture.

How is the depth of field of a camera controlled?
For a given subject framing and camera position, the DOF is controlled by the lens aperture diameter, which is usually specified as the f-number (the ratio of lens focal length to aperture diameter).
